The authors elaborate a new method of \(G^{k,l}\)-constrained multi-degree reducing Bézier curves with respect to the least squares norm. This method has better complexity than the existing ones. First of all, the specific continuity conditions are related with the control points. A model of the multi-degree reduction with prescribed boundary control points is described. The optimum values of the parameters are obtained by minimizing the least squares error function, discussing two possibilities: an optimization method (either the interactive active-set method or a sequential quadratic programming method) and solving a system of linear equations. The implementation of the described algorithm is accompanied by practical examples and compared with existing techniques.
